Job Description

Category Imaging - Cath Lab Tech Job Type Travel Discover the Southern charm and hospitality of Lake Park, GA, while expanding your career as a traveling imaging professional. Immerse yourself in this warm, welcoming region known for its beautiful lakes, serene parks, and friendly community spirit. Working here provides a unique blend of professional fulfillment and the chance to immerse yourself in the cultural richness and natural beauty that the area offers. This travel assignment offers a fantastic chance to work alongside experienced leaders in a robust healthcare environment, gaining exposure to diverse clinical practices and leadership perspectives. Not only will you enhance your technical skills as a Cath Lab Tech, but you'll also have the opportunity to collaborate with interdisciplinary teams, adding valuable, real-world experience to your resume. Schedule/Hours 4x10-hour day shifts (07:00 - 17:00) Guaranteed 40 hours per week Flexibility to explore the region during extended downtime Desired Qualifications At least 2 years of experience as a Cath Lab Tech (first-time travelers are welcome) Current certifications: ARRT(R), BLS, and ACLS Experience working with adult and geriatric patients Proficiency with EPIC electronic documentation system Strong interpersonal skills and the ability to work collaboratively in a dynamic setting Key Responsibilities Perform diagnostic and interventional procedures in the Cath Lab Monitor and respond to patient needs during procedures Accurately document procedures and patient data using EPIC Collaborate with provider support teams, including pharmacy, radiology, and rapid response Uphold best practices and safety standards Benefits & Perks Tax-advantaged stipends to support your travel and living expenses Comprehensive travel assistance for a smooth transition Premium compensation package Healthcare coverage and 401(k) options for peace of mind and future security Access to support services including interpreter, pharmacy, radiology, respiratory, and social services Guaranteed hours for job stability and consistent income Take this opportunity to elevate your career and enjoy new adventures in Lake Park.
